**Vendor note: Inkmill markdown pipeline**

Rendering for Parchway docs is outsourced to Inkmill under an annual contract, renewing each March. They handle sanitization and PDF export; we own the upload queue. SLA: 4-hour response on rendering failures. Escalate only after two failed retries. Their support desk is reachable at the address below.

billing contact of hahaf-baguf = zorael.tammir.jorius@sivrelhq.internal

## Project Kestrel — Possible Acquisition (Managers Only)

This page summarises, for the board, the status of our evaluation of Tarnow Systems, a mid-sized analytics firm. Due diligence on financials and key contracts is roughly 70% complete; no material issues so far. Valuation discussions remain in an early range and exclusivity runs to quarter end. Access to this page is restricted — do not reference Project Kestrel in general channels. The strategic rationale and next steps are captured in the confidential note that follows.

board note of bajop-yaweg: The western region missed its Pelys quota by 58.0 percent last quarter. Pelysek Foods plans to raise the Belius list price by 44.0 percent in July. The steering committee signed off on a budget of $133.8 million for Project Pelax. The renewal with Zoraelix Systems closes at $61.9 million a year, 12.7 percent above the last contract.

## Runbook: Kicking an incremental rebuild

If Pagesmith skips changed content, don't panic — the diff cache in Shardbox probably went stale. Clear it with `pagesmith cache flush`, then trigger an incremental rebuild from the Relay dashboard. For CLI triggers you'll need to auth against the rebuild endpoint with the key below.

app token of yajeg-kawef = kto11_7En3XSX8xQw

Thanks for reviewing PR batches on Ladlewise! The recipe-scaling calculator lives in packages/scaler — it converts yields and rounds units sensibly, so watch for floating-point edge cases in reviews. To run the integration suite locally, the tests hit our sandbox nutrition API, which requires an auth token in your .env. Add this line first.

secret setting of tagug-kajof: VAULT_KEY5=96292